The cheapest way to get from Segorbe to Salou is to bus which costs €20 - €25 and takes 4h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Segorbe to Salou is to drive which takes 2h 23m and costs €35 - €55.
No, there is no direct bus from Segorbe to Salou. However, there are services departing from Segorbe and arriving at Pg. Jaume via Tarragona Estació d'autobusos.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 50m.
The distance between Segorbe and Salou is 260 km. The road distance is 233.5 km.
The best way to get from Segorbe to Salou without a car is to bus which takes 4h 50m and costs €20 - €25.
It takes approximately 4h 50m to get from Segorbe to Salou, including transfers.

What companies run services between Segorbe, Spain and Salou, Spain?
Autocares Grupo Samar operates a bus from Segorbe to Tarragona 5 times a week. Tickets cost €19–22 and the journey takes 3h 45m. Alternatively, Renfe Viajeros operates a train from Sagunto to Camp De Tarragona once a week. Tickets cost €20–27 and the journey takes 2h 28m.
